What is Pediatric Laparoscopic Surgery?

Pediatric laparoscopic surgery, also known as minimally invasive surgery or keyhole surgery, is a specialized surgical technique that utilizes small incisions and a laparoscope—a long, thin instrument with a camera—to perform procedures inside the abdomen or pelvis. It offers several advantages over traditional open surgery, including smaller incisions, reduced pain, shorter recovery time, and improved cosmetic outcomes.

Benefits of Pediatric Laparoscopic Surgery

Pediatric laparoscopic surgery provides numerous benefits for young patients, including:

Minimally Invasive Approach: Laparoscopic surgery uses small incisions, resulting in less trauma to the body compared to traditional open surgery. This minimizes pain, reduces scarring, and promotes faster recovery.

Reduced Pain and Discomfort: The smaller incisions in laparoscopic surgery lead to less postoperative pain and discomfort compared to larger incisions in open surgery. This allows for quicker mobilization and faster return to normal activities.

Shorter Hospital Stay: Children who undergo laparoscopic surgery often experience shorter hospital stays, allowing them to return home and resume their regular routines sooner.

Faster Recovery Time: Laparoscopic surgery typically offers a quicker recovery compared to open surgery. Children may experience less disruption to their daily activities, school attendance, and overall quality of life.

Improved Cosmetic Outcomes: Laparoscopic surgery results in smaller scars and improved cosmetic outcomes, which can be particularly important for young patients who may be self-conscious about their appearance.

Common Pediatric Laparoscopic Procedures

Pediatric laparoscopic surgery can be used to address various conditions and perform a range of procedures, including:

Appendectomy: Laparoscopic appendectomy is the removal of the appendix and is commonly performed to treat appendicitis in children.

Cholecystectomy: Laparoscopic cholecystectomy is the removal of the gallbladder and is typically performed to treat gallstones or gallbladder-related conditions in children.

Hernia Repair: Laparoscopic hernia repair is used to correct inguinal hernias or umbilical hernias in children, offering a minimally invasive alternative to traditional open hernia repair.

Biopsies: Laparoscopic biopsies can be performed to obtain tissue samples for diagnostic purposes in cases involving suspected tumors or other abdominal conditions.

Treatment of Gastrointestinal Conditions: Laparoscopic surgery can be used to treat a range of gastrointestinal conditions in children, including bowel obstructions, intestinal malformations, and inflammatory bowel disease.
